The Power of Standards and the Advantages of Socket Head Screws

The concept of socket head screws is defined in technical literature as cylindrical head hex screws, and the greatest advantage of these products is that the hexagonal recess in their heads allows them to be tightened with high torque even in confined spaces. The DIN 912 standard connects the dimensions, tolerances, and material properties of these products to clear, globally accepted rules. For users, this standard provides the assurance that a product purchased will meet the same technical values regardless of where it is used in the world. Especially in critical areas such as machine manufacturing, the automotive sector, the furniture industry, and automation systems, the precision of fasteners directly facilitates the assembly process.

Precision Engineering Dimensions and Technical Details

Regarding technical details, the structural dimensions offered by the DIN 912 standard are the fundamental guide for error-free assembly in engineering projects. According to the chart, thread pitches (P) for nominal diameters ranging from M3 to M14 have been meticulously determined between 0.50 mm and 2.00 mm. For example, for an M8 bolt, the head diameter (d) is standardized at a maximum of 13.00 mm and a minimum of 12.73 mm. The socket width (s) has precise tolerances ranging from 6.02 mm to 6.14 mm for the M8 size. This dimensional precision ensures that the Allen key used fits perfectly into the socket, guaranteeing that torque is transferred without loss and preventing the bolt head from deforming.

Material Quality and Strength Classes

The first detail that professionals seeking a quality fastener must pay attention to is the material class and surface coating of the bolt. DIN 912 bolts are generally manufactured in 8.8, 10.9, and 12.9 quality classes. These classes express the load the bolt can carry and its resistance to the tension it may be exposed to. For instance, a 12.9 quality bolt is produced from high-strength steel and exhibits excellent performance in heavy industrial applications. Material and Precision in Manufacturing Technology

Raw material quality is the most critical stage in the production process of DIN 912 bolts. Bolts produced using the cold forging method exhibit a superior profile in terms of breaking and fatigue resistance due to the preservation of their fiber structure. Threading processes must be flawless in terms of thread depth and angle. This is because even the slightest tolerance deviation in the thread structure can damage the nut or threaded housing during assembly. Therefore, compliance with international quality standards is not just a certificate but the basis of safe engineering work.
